The number of $100 bills that fit in an inch depends on the thickness of the bills. A standard U.S. bill is approximately 0.0043 inches thick, so you can fit about 232 $100 bills in one inch (1 inch divided by 0.0043 inches). Keep in mind that this is a theoretical calculation, as practical factors may affect the actual number.

The US dollar bill is 2.6" by 6.1". So in terms of width, 20.5/6.1 = 3.36 dollar bills can fit along one side of the wall. In terms of height, 37/2.6 = 14.23 dollar bills can fit along the other side of the wall. I'm rounding up to 4 dollar bills in width and 15 for height (some will need to be cut). So for the whole area, 4*15 = 60 dollar bills total.
